Understanding Rayon Twill Fabric: Origins and Characteristics

Rayon twill fabric is really something special. It’s become quite popular among sewing lovers out there, thanks to its unique feel and versatility. To give you a quick rundown—rayon comes from plant-based cellulose fibers, and it’s known for being super soft, breathable, and having a lovely drape. The twill weave just takes those qualities a step further, making the fabric not only feel luxurious against your skin but also look really chic with that beautiful drape in whatever you’re making. If you’re into fabrics that mimic silk without the high price tag, rayon twill is a fantastic choice. Whether you’re crafting elegant dresses or just comfy everyday wear, it’s pretty much perfect for a bunch of different projects.

Tips and Techniques for Sewing with Rayon Twill Fabric

Rayon twill fabric is really starting to catch on among sewing enthusiasts, and it’s easy to see why—it's just so comfy and versatile. When you're working with this fabric, it helps to get familiar with its quirks so you can get the best results. It’s lightweightbut drapes beautifully, which makes it perfect for flowing dresses and skirts that need that nice, elegant hang. I read somewhere that the use of Rayon Fabrics, including twill, has gone up by about25% over the past five years in the fashion world. No surprise there, right? People are definitely loving how it looks and feels.

If you want to sew with rayon twill without any hiccups, it’s a good idea to pre-wash it first—this helps prevent shrinking or fading later on. Using a ballpoint needle can really make a difference, since it helps avoid snagging, and a walking foot is super helpful because this fabric can be a bit slippery. The folks at the Sewing and Craft Alliance also suggest finishing techniques like French seams or bias binding, which give your pieces that polished, professional look and help keep fraying at bay. Just by keeping these tips in mind, you can craft stylish, durable garments that highlight what makes rayon twill so special—kind of like sewing magic, if you ask me.

Care Instructions for Maintaining Rayon Twill Garments and Projects

Rayon twill fabric is pretty popular among sewing fans because of its unique feel and how versatile it is. But, if you want your rayon twill garments to stay looking good and feeling soft, you gotta take care when washing them. Usually, it's best to wash rayon in cold water and with clothes of similar colors—doing this helps prevent colors from bleeding and shrinking. Oh, and definitely steer clear of bleach—it can wreck the fibers and change how the fabric looks.

Talking about stains, quick action is key. If you get a spill, try to deal with it asap to avoid stubborn marks. You can use a mild stain remover, but, honestly, it’s smart to test it on a hidden part of the fabric first — just to make sure it doesn’t cause any discoloration. When drying, it's better to go with a low heat setting in the dryer or lay the garment flat to air dry. And if your piece says 'dry-clean only,' don’t panic—sometimes you can hand wash it gently instead, but always double-check the care label first. Better safe than sorry, right?
